Compliance context

AB 802 (Public Resources Code §25402.10)

A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.

Frequently asked questions

What is Villas Las Americas's energy grade?

Villas Las Americas scores 94 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band A (High performer (85–100)) — in its 2021 California dis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does Villas Las Americas use?

Its 2021 site energy-use intensity was 42.8 kBtu/ft² across 70,245 sq ft, including 388,343 kWh of electricity and 16,304 therms of natural gas.

What are Villas Las Americas's carbon emissions?

Villas Las Americas reported 167 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(2.4 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2021. A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.
